Hydrogen peroxide method for axillary whitening
Human skin, the underarms, or for various reasons, have a darker color. Today there is a method that can be used to whiten the underarms with hydrogen peroxide.
Hydrogen peroxide, a common chemical substance, is used here, and has a wonderful effect. Method: Prepare an appropriate amount of hydrogen peroxide solution first. The concentration should be moderate. If it is too thick, it may hurt the skin. If it is too thin, the effect will be difficult to show. Dip the solution in a clean cloth and gently wipe the underarm skin. The action should be slow, so that the solution is evenly covered under the armpits. After wiping, wait for a while, but do not leave it for a long time to prevent skin damage. Then wash with water and wipe dry.
When doing this method, pay attention. First, try it on a small area of the skin first to see if there is any allergy or discomfort. If the skin is red and itchy, it cannot be used. Second, be careful during the operation, and do not let the solution into the eyes, mouth and other sensitive areas. Third, do not use it frequently, and it is advisable to use it at appropriate intervals to ensure healthy skin. In this way, with perseverance, the skin under the armpits may gradually lighten.
